Exercise motivation is complicated. You know you should move. Sometimes you want to. Often you don't. The gym membership gathers dust while guilt accumulates. Understanding your exercise relationship helps build something sustainable.

AI journaling supports exercise motivation: exploring your resistance, finding what actually works, and building lasting movement habits.


Understanding Exercise Motivation

Why It's Hard

Exercise resistance comes from:

  • Past negative associations.
  • All-or-nothing thinking.
  • Wrong type of movement.
  • Expectations too high.

Common Patterns

People struggle with:

  • Starting motivated, then stopping.
  • Exercise as punishment.
  • Comparison to others.
  • Perfectionism about fitness.

What Actually Works

Sustainable movement requires:

  • Movement you enjoy.
  • Realistic expectations.
  • Intrinsic motivation.
  • Flexibility and self-compassion.

Exercise Motivation Practices

The Resistance Exploration

Understanding why:

  1. What stops me from exercising?
  2. What associations do I have with exercise?
  3. What would make movement appealing?
  4. What's my real resistance about?

The Why Reflection

Finding your reason:

  1. Why do I want to exercise (really)?
  2. Beyond appearance, what do I want?
  3. How do I want to feel?
  4. What would consistent movement give me?

The Enjoyment Discovery

Finding what works:

  1. What movement have I enjoyed in the past?
  2. What sounds fun, not punishing?
  3. What would I do if it didn't have to be at a gym?
  4. What would playful movement look like?

The Realistic Planning

Making it sustainable:

  1. What's actually realistic for my life?
  2. What's the minimum I could commit to?
  3. How can I make it easier to start?
  4. What would remove barriers?
